Montelukast Asthmatic Smoker Study (0476-332)(COMPLETED)
A Multicenter, Randomized, Double-Blind, Parallel-Group 6-Month Study to Evaluate the Efficacy and Safety of Oral Montelukast Sodium, Fluticasone Propionate and Placebo in Patients With Chronic Asthma Who Smoke Cigarettes

Summary
This is a multicenter study to evaluate the efficacy and safety of MK0476 versus placebo in participants with chronic asthma who actively smoke cigarettes.
Conditions
Interventions
| Type | Name | Description |
|---|---|---|
| DRUG | montelukast sodium | montelukast 10 mg tablet once daily, 6 month treatment period |
| DRUG | Comparator: Placebo | fluticasone propionate 250 mcg Placebo (Pbo) twice daily, 6 month treatment period |
| DRUG | Comparator: fluticasone | fluticasone propionate 250 mcg twice daily, 6 month treatment period |
| DRUG | Comparator: Placebo | montelukast 10 mg Pbo tablet once daily, 6 month treatment period |
